About The Position

MainStreet Family Care is seeking a full-time Family Nurse Practitioner (FNP) to join their growing team in Kinston, NC. This role focuses on providing patient-centered care to help patients feel better quickly. The clinic offers urgent care, primary medical care, telemedicine, and occupational medicine services. The ideal candidate will be able to lead a small team in a high-volume, fast-paced urgent care setting. This opportunity is suitable for new graduates, with comprehensive training and ongoing support provided, including a complimentary pediatric urgent care course and access to an on-call provider for clinical decision-making. FNPs will utilize their full scope of practice, treating patients of all ages from infants to geriatrics, which helps maintain and enhance clinical skills. The role emphasizes leadership, with FNPs acting as the primary medical provider in the clinic, supported by treatment protocols and a team of medical assistants. There is also an opportunity to mentor and inspire medical assistants. The clinics serve rural communities with limited access to care, operating 362 days a year. Many clinics qualify for state-funded tuition reimbursement or student loan reimbursement grants, and the company assists with the application process. This position is presented as a two-year commitment with significant returns for career growth.

Responsibilities

  • Care for every patient who comes through the door within your scope of practice.
  • Diagnosing and treating cold, flu, strep, COVID, and other upper respiratory issues.
  • Performing minor procedures (toenail removal, foreign object removal, etc.).
  • Suturing.
  • Splinting.
  • General Orthopedic evaluations/management.
  • Review of x-rays (to be over-read by Radiologist, too).
  • General Dermatology.
  • General eye problems.
  • General EKG interpretations.
  • Emergency management skills.
  • General GYN expertise.
  • Treating children of all ages.
  • Occupational medicine.
  • Telemedicine.
